Two-wheeled fire-fighting balance car with automatic fire source recognition and fire extinguishing functions
By designing a two-wheeled fire-fighting balance vehicle with autonomous fire source identification and extinguishing functions, and using STM32 microcontrollers and sensor modules, the problems of complex structure and high cost of existing fire-fighting robots have been solved. This vehicle achieves highly intelligent fire source identification and extinguishing efficiency, making it suitable for fire-fighting tasks in confined spaces.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the field of intelligent fire rescue equipment, and specifically relates to a two-wheeled fire balance car with autonomous fire source identification and fire extinguishing functions. BACKGROUND
[0002] In the field of fire rescue, traditional manual investigation and fire extinguishing methods have high risk and low efficiency. In recent years, with the rapid development of robot technology, fire robots have gradually become an important tool for replacing manual operation in dangerous environments. However, most existing fire robots have complex structures, high costs, and limited intelligence. Therefore, it is of great significance to develop a fire balance car with simple structure, low cost, and high intelligence.
[0003] In the prior art, there are some balance car products based on microcontrollers and computing platforms, but most of these products are applied in entertainment, transportation and other fields, and there are few products specially designed and optimized for fire scenes. In addition, these products also have deficiencies in intelligent control, fire source identification, and fire extinguishing efficiency. SUMMARY
[0004] To solve the above technical problems, the utility model provides a two-wheeled fire balance car with autonomous fire source identification and fire extinguishing functions.
[0005] The utility model discloses a kind of two-wheeled fire balance car with autonomous fire source identification and fire extinguishing functions according to the utility model, including car body, the car body includes first bearing plate, second bearing plate, third bearing plate, pedestal from top to bottom, the two sides of the pedestal are symmetrically arranged walking wheel, the walking wheel is installed on the output shaft of motor and is equipped with encoder on the output shaft of motor, laser radar and camera are provided on the first bearing plate, main controller and fan are provided on the second bearing plate, the third bearing plate is provided with STM32 microcontroller, motor drive module, OLED module, fire alarm module, sensor module including smoke sensor and infrared sensor, attitude sensor, fan drive module integrated with STM32 microcontroller main board including 360 degree turntable installed with fire extinguishing module, voice communication unit, power module is provided on the pedestal;
[0006] The input end of the STM32 microcontroller is electrically connected with the sensor module, the attitude sensor and the encoder, and the output end of the STM32 microcontroller is electrically connected with the motor drive module, the OLED module, the fire alarm module, the fire extinguishing module and the fan drive module. The main controller is connected with the STM32 microcontroller through wired communication, and the main controller is electrically connected with the laser radar, the camera and the voice communication unit.
[0007] By employing the aforementioned technical solution, this utility model has the following beneficial effects:
[0008] (1) The fire balance vehicle adopts a two-wheel drive structure with high mobility, can achieve 360-degree rotation, and has high stability. When it is disturbed by external forces, it can still recover its posture, making it particularly suitable for performing firefighting tasks in narrow spaces.
[0009] (2) The fire-fighting balance vehicle can build an environmental map by combining the main controller with the existing autonomous navigation algorithm to achieve autonomous navigation; it can quickly identify the location of the fire source through the camera and infrared sensor and the fire detection range is wider. When the fire source is detected, the turntable is adjusted according to the location of the fire source to achieve autonomous fire extinguishing; in terms of fire extinguishing, the fire-fighting balance vehicle can control the fire extinguishing module through the microcontroller to extinguish the fire, which can greatly improve the efficiency of fire extinguishing.
[0010] (3) The fire-fighting balance vehicle has a simple body structure and low cost.
[0011] Furthermore, the base is provided with a plurality of screws, which pass through the aforementioned first bearing plate, second bearing plate, and third bearing plate, and the first bearing plate, second bearing plate, and third bearing plate are respectively placed on the corresponding nuts screwed onto the screws.
[0012] Its beneficial effects are: rotating the nut can adjust the space between the base and the third support plate, as well as between two adjacent support plates, which greatly expands the applicability of the fire-fighting balance vehicle.
[0013] Furthermore, the top surface of the first bearing plate is provided with another nut screwed onto the screw.
[0014] Its beneficial effect is that the nuts set on the top and bottom surfaces make the first bearing plate more stable.
[0015] Furthermore, guardrails are symmetrically arranged on the first bearing plate along the front-to-back direction.
[0016] Its beneficial effect is that it prevents the device on the first load-bearing plate from falling off due to changes in the speed of the trolley when the fire-fighting balance vehicle is moving.
[0017] Furthermore, the attitude sensor employs an MPU6050 module.
[0018] Furthermore, the main controller adopts the Sunrise X3Pie computing platform.
[0019] Furthermore, the STM32 microcontroller is an STM32F103RCT6 microcontroller.
[0020] Furthermore, the motor drive module uses the AT8236 motor drive chip.
[0021] Further, the main controller is in wireless communication connection with a control terminal, and the control terminal comprises a fire control center PC control terminal and a mobile terminal carried by a fireman.
[0022] Further, the voice communication unit comprises a microphone and a loudspeaker.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ION
[0029] The technical scheme of the present application will be further described in detail below in conjunction with the drawings:
[0030] A two-wheeled fire-fighting balance car with autonomous fire source identification and fire extinguishing function, comprising a car body (please refer to Figure 1 For the sake of illustrating the technical scheme, Figure 1(Some parts are omitted). The vehicle body includes a first support plate 1, a second support plate 2, a third support plate 3, and a base 4 arranged from top to bottom. The base 4 is provided with several screws 8 (for example, in this embodiment, one screw 8 is provided at each of the four corners of the base 4). After the screws 8 pass through the first support plate 1, the second support plate 2, and the third support plate 3, the first support plate 1, the second support plate 2, and the third support plate 3 are respectively placed on corresponding nuts 9 screwed onto the screws 8. In this embodiment, the corresponding nuts 9 can be rotated to move the first support plate 1, the second support plate 2, and the third support plate 3 vertically up and down, thereby changing the space between two adjacent support plates, which is beneficial for the installation and maintenance of various functional modules, and also for the installation of different models of functional modules, expanding the application range of the fire-fighting balance vehicle. Furthermore, another nut 9 screwed onto the screw 8 is provided on the top surface of the first support plate 1, making the first support plate 1 more stable. Of course, the second support plate 2 and the third support plate 3 can also be screwed onto the screws 8 simultaneously. Nuts 9 are also provided on the top surface to make the overall structure of the fire-fighting balance vehicle more robust and improve its stability when walking. Walking wheels 7 are symmetrically arranged on both sides of the base 4. The walking wheels 7 are mounted on the output shaft of the motor 5 and the output shaft of the motor 5 is equipped with an encoder 6. The first support plate 1 is symmetrically arranged with guardrails 10 in the front-rear direction. A camera 12 is installed on the front wall of the first support plate 1. A laser radar 11 is placed between the two guardrails 10 to ensure the stability of the laser radar 11 on the first support plate 1 when walking. The second support plate 2 is equipped with a main controller 13 (in this embodiment, the main controller adopts the Sunrise X3 Pie computing platform) and a fan. The third support plate 3 is equipped with an STM32 microcontroller main control board 14 integrating an STM32 microcontroller, a motor drive module, an OLED module, a fire alarm module, a sensor module, an MPU6050 module, and a fan drive module, as well as a 360-degree turntable and a voice communication unit. The base 4 is equipped with a power module 16. This fire-fighting balance vehicle uses a two-wheel drive structure. The motor 5 controls the speed of the walking wheels to achieve forward, backward, and 360-degree turning functions. It also has high stability and can recover its posture when disturbed by external forces. At the same time, it has high mobility and can perform fire-fighting tasks in narrow spaces.
[0031] like Figure 2 As shown, the two-wheeled fire-fighting balance vehicle also includes an STM32 microcontroller, a motor drive module, an OLED module, a fire alarm module, a fire extinguishing module, a sensor module, an MPU6050 module, a motor 5, an encoder 6, a main controller 13, a camera 12, a lidar 11, a voice communication unit, and a fan drive module.
[0032] The STM32 microcontroller used is the STM32F103RCT6 microcontroller, and its schematic diagram is shown below.Figure 3 The MPU6050 module is a kind of attitude sensor, which integrates three-axis accelerometer and three-axis gyroscope, and an extendable digital motion processor DMP, the DMP can process the data of the accelerometer and gyroscope in real time, and transmit the real-time attitude information of the trolley to the STM32 microcontroller.

[0034] The motor driving module adopts AT8236 motor driving chip; the encoder 6 is used for feeding back the position, speed and acceleration information of the motor, and the microcontroller transmits the information to the STM32 microcontroller through the AT8236 motor driving chip, and the microcontroller adjusts the rotating speed of the motor 5 through the AT8236 motor driving chip using the balance control PID algorithm, and then controls the speed of the trolley, so as to realize the balance control of the fire balance car.
[0035] The sensor module includes a smoke sensor and an infrared sensor, the smoke sensor is used for detecting the smoke concentration of the fire scene, the infrared sensor is used for detecting the temperature of the fire scene and identifying the fire source position, and the sensor module transmits the information to the STM32 microcontroller, and the microcontroller transmits the information to the main controller 13 after receiving the information, and sends an alarm instruction to the fire alarm module, so that the fire source position can be quickly determined.
[0036] The OLED module includes an OLED display screen, which is used for displaying the planned route, fire position, obstacle information and real-time position information of the fire balance car.
[0037] The fire extinguishing module is installed on the 360-degree rotary table, and can realize 360-degree direction adjustment, when the fire balance car detects the fire source, the position of the fire source is identified through the infrared sensor, and then the rotary table is adjusted to turn, the STM32 microcontroller controls the fire extinguishing module to extinguish the fire source, for example, in the actual experiment, when the fire extinguishing device carries water resources, it can effectively spray 80% of the fire extinguishing water flow within 3 meters, and the success rate of fire extinguishing is improved, of course, in other embodiments of the utility model, the fire extinguishing device can carry other types of fire extinguishing resources (such as carbon dioxide).
[0038] In this embodiment, the STM32 microcontroller and the host controller 13 are connected by a USB serial port for wired communication. The host controller 13 is an X3 computing platform loaded with the ROS operating system. The computing platform can run existing autonomous navigation algorithms (such as the SLAM algorithm) to build a more accurate environment map, run existing global path planning algorithms (such as the A* algorithm) and existing local path planning algorithms (such as the TEB algorithm) to determine the optimal global path, and run existing visual recognition algorithms (such as the YOLOV5 detection algorithm) to identify fire sources and fire scenes.
[0039] The camera 12 can obtain real-time information of the fire scene and monitor the fire source. The laser radar 11 can analyze whether there is an obstacle in front and determine the turning direction according to the obstacle information, and can detect the distance of objects within a 360-degree range. The laser radar 11 and the camera 12 send the real-time information obtained by themselves to the host controller for assisting path planning and navigation.
[0040] The voice communication unit includes a microphone and a speaker 15, which can communicate with trapped personnel in real time. Firefighters can comfort and evacuate trapped personnel, and carry rescue items according to the needs of trapped personnel.
[0041] The host controller 13 communicates with the control terminal wirelessly to realize data interaction. The control terminal includes a fire center PC control terminal and a mobile terminal carried by a firefighter. During fire rescue, the fire center PC control terminal can be remotely controlled by a computer. Firefighters near the fire scene communicate with the host controller of the fire balancing vehicle wirelessly (such as Bluetooth communication) through the mobile terminal carried by themselves. With the interactive interface of the PC and the interactive interface of the mobile terminal, the camera monitored screen can be displayed in real time, and the data of fire extinguishing agent, smoke concentration, temperature, etc. can be displayed in real time.
[0042] In specific implementation, the power module 16 is powered by a battery. According to the size of the output voltage, a corresponding existing voltage reduction circuit is arranged to realize the power supply of the above-mentioned various modules. For example: the output voltage is 12V, which is directly input into the motor driving chip to drive the motor; 12V voltage is reduced to 5V through a voltage reduction circuit (in this embodiment, we use a voltage reduction chip RT8289GSP) for power supply of the above-mentioned various modules.
[0043] When the fire-fighting balance car is working, the laser radar 11 and the camera 12 monitor the surrounding environment in real time, the preset environment map and the planned travel route are displayed on the OLED display screen through the main controller 13 to determine the optimal global path; the microcontroller judges the current smoke concentration according to the information transmitted by the smoke sensor, and when the smoke concentration is too high, the fan driving module drives the fan to disperse the smoke to prevent affecting the detection; when the fire source is identified, the fire-fighting balance car can monitor the fire scene in real time through the camera 12, accurately identify the fire source position through the infrared sensor, and immediately issue an alarm once the fire source or trapped personnel is found; when the fire extinguishing operation is performed, the microcontroller starts the fire extinguishing module to extinguish the fire at the fire source position after the fire-fighting balance car reaches the fire source position; after completing the fire extinguishing operation, the fire-fighting balance car will return to the starting point along the path; when the main controller 13 of the fire-fighting balance car and the control terminal have communication failure, the fire-fighting balance car will stop immediately and return to the starting point along the path.
[0044] Of course, in other embodiments of the present application, four telescopic rods can be provided between the base and the third bearing plate and between the adjacent two bearing plates to replace the screw rod and the nut; a baffle can be provided on the first bearing plate to replace the barrier rod.
